Hello Alaa,just navigate to the simobjects/airplanes/pmdg, and delete the folder 'texture.aa' and also remove it from the cfg file,then reinstall thetexture from the texture manager again,
Hello JudeJust wanted to let you know that I followed the instructions, successfully, the load manager installed all liveries, there was a little trick though, the aircraft.cfg was a read only file I undo that and it worked beautifully.Million of thanks Sir
